What's new in v3.2.2322142628.700722.580383
Introduces new wireless audio protocol. HTC Connect now supports:
- AllPlay speakers
- AirPlay audio
- Bluetooth speakers
- DLNA audio
- Google Chromecast
- Harmon Kardon Omni speakers
- Miracast.

Common install errors for HTC Connect
- "App not installed" — usually means an older or differently-signed version is already on your device. Uninstall it first, then retry. Your data may be lost unless you back it up.
- "Parse error" — the APK is for a newer Android than yours. This version needs Android API 17 or later. Pick an older build from the versions list below.
- "There was a problem parsing the package" — the download was interrupted. Delete the file and re-download over Wi-Fi.
